Although not yet publicly announced, The Art Newspaper can reveal that the Philadelphia Art Museum will next year hold an exhibition entitled Van Gogh's Sunflowers: A Symphony in Blue and Yellow (6 June-11 October 2026). According to a museum spokesperson, the show "will bring together two Sunflower paintings, considering how the artist used colour and brushwork to different expressive effects".
